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kempton Park to Beaulieu Road start from £37.80 one way, or £38.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kempton Park to Beaulieu Road are available for £48.60 one way, or £49.10 return

Facilities at Kempton Park Station

While Kempton Park might surprise you with its quaintness, it doesn't fall short of basic facilities. You won't find a ticket office here, but there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ets. This is perfect for those who prefer the flexibility of buying tickets online. Accessibility is a key factor at Kempton Park, with ticket machines supporting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Should you need assistance, use the help points located within the station, where staff are happy to assist via help lines. Keep in mind there are no wa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ities, so it's best to plan ahead if you need any of these services.

Onward Travel from Kempton Park

Traveling beyond Kempton Park Station is a breeze with various transport links. The station provides clear information for bus routes, including maps for planning your onward journey. If rail service faces any disruptions, rail replacement services run toward Shepperton and Fulwell from Staines Road East. Station Facilities and Accessibility

Beaulieu Road, despite its idyllic location, offers limited amenities. No ticket office or machines are available, meaning purchasing a Permit to Travel is necessary, which can be exchanged for a ticket on the train. However, the Permit to Travel machine is not wheelchair accessible. The station has a help point but lacks CCTV, making personal vigilance essential for security. For those requiring step-free access, be aware that only parts of the station are accessible without steps, with challenging uneven paths and an overall B3 accessibility rating.

Facilities at Beaulieu Road are basic, with no toilets, refreshment kiosks, or waiting rooms. While there is a designated seating area, travelers should plan ahead, especially if arriving early or expecting delays. The absence of certain facilities may seem a drawback, but it adds to the station's rustic allure, encouraging visitors to immerse themselves in the surrounding natural beauty.

Getting to and From Beaulieu Road

Travelers interested in onward journeys will find limited local transport links. There is no dedicated bus service from the station; however, a Rail Replacement Service operates from the Station Approach Road. For those planning further expeditions by bus, details are available here. The lack of a taxi rank necessitates pre-booking or alternative arrangements.
